Finances, Blackfriars And Leases.

In a video interview posted by the club this afternoon, Hereford chairman Jon Hale spoke about finances of the club, the Blackfriars End and the length of the lease amidst other topics.

"There's been committments on the financial side that we've had to make," said Hale.

"Attendances last season weren't great, lots of reasons for that,

"Finances can always be improved and we're not going to say we've got lots of money because we haven't.

"We are very aware that we need to build up the reserves again because over the last three or four years there has been money spent. But there's no reason why we can't do that and look to the future and being aware of things like promotion and how we might finance that.

"There are the conversations we are having at board level to make sure we are ready."

The Blackfriars End.

"All I can say is that I make contact recently with the council and will be having a meeting with them, hopefully in the next couple of months, where we've got some ideas, hopefully they've got some ideas.

"We need to make some movement on it. There have been too many false dawns.

"Interestingly when we did the recent supporter questionaire a number of people said they would love to see something happen at that end. We agree with that, we want to see something to happen but we're almost at the start of the process again because certain ideas the council had previously haven't come to fruition, it might be a case of us saying well how about this."

How long has the lease on Edgar Street got left?

"It might be seven and a half years.

"I would like to see that lease twenty five years plus because we could tap into funding, there's a lot of ground maintenance to do here which is going to cost money over a period of time.

"With seven and a half years left we can't tap into those funding pots but there might be funding pots we can dip into for the Blackfriars, certain projects we might have there.

"All things are open at the moment, we look at every angle but conversations are always happening. We're aware of some challenges ahead but a lot of it goes back to the length of the lease.

"I think the council will understand but we need to get something on paper."
